The Dark Theatre

A Book About Loss

More about the book

Set in the backdrop of London's Docklands, the narrative explores the impact of financialisation, austerity, and communicative capitalism over four decades. Through the lens of Alan Read's experiences in the 1980s, it delves into a period marked by cultural cruelty and the struggles faced in a once-thriving warehouse now in disarray. The text examines how these forces have shaped the cultural landscape, reflecting on the intersection of art and economic hardship.
